The North West Fund for Venture Capital is designed to support entrepreneurs building high growth businesses in the North West region. It invests from £50k to £2m in new and early stage start-up companies in return for an equity share. This Fund is part of the £155m North West Fund which is financed by the European Regional Development Fund and the European Investment Bank as part of the JEREMIE programme, which aims to improve access to finance for SMEs. To qualify for these funds your business must be based in the North West.
